  • Patent number: 10563347
    Abstract: According to the present disclosure, a resin product is brought into contact with a treatment liquid containing an antibacterial antifungal compound (A) of a quaternary ammonium salt compound having a molecular weight of not greater than 1500 and, in this state, heat-treated under a normal atmospheric pressure or under an increased pressure, whereby the antibacterial antifungal compound (A) is immobilized on at least a surface of the resin product. Thus, an excellent antibacterial/antifungal finished product having water resistance and laundry durability is provided.

  • Publication number: 20170167075
    Abstract: According to the present disclosure, a resin product is brought in contact with a treatment liquid containing an antiviral compound (A) of a quaternary ammonium halide having a molecular weight of not greater than 1500 and, in this state, heat-treated under a normal pressure or under an increased pressure, whereby the antiviral compound (A) is immobilized on at least a surface of the resin product. Thus, an excellent antiviral finished product having water resistance and laundry durability is provided.
